'From shelter camps to destroyed homes': After 15 months of war, thousands of Palestinians return to Gaza

Last updated on - Jan 27, 2025, 15:18 IST

Returning to ruins

Throngs of displaced Palestinians make their way back to the war-torn northern Gaza Strip after a fragile ceasefire allows movement across the region. (AP photo)

Fragile ceasefire holds

Despite previous truce violations, a new deal between Israel and Hamas facilitates the release of six hostages and paves the way for further negotiations. (AP photo)

Hostage negotiations continue

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u announces the phased release of six hostages, in the ongoing conflict. (PTI photo)

The long walk home

Displaced Palestinians navigate rubble-strewn streets, clutching belongings as they attempt to return to what remains of their homes. (AP photo)

Trump's controversial proposal

Former US President Donald Trump suggests relocating Gaza's population to neighbouring countries, sparking widespread condemnation. (AP photo)

Palestinian rejection of displacement

Leaders and citizens of Gaza condemn any plans for forced displacement, invoking memories of the 1948 Nakba. (AP photo)

Regional pushback against displacement

Jordan and Egypt strongly reject proposals to move Gaza’s population, emphasising Palestinian rights and sovereignty. (AP photo)

Dire humanitarian situation

Aid trucks enter Gaza, but the United Nations warns the humanitarian crisis remains severe as food, medicine, and fuel are insufficient. (AP photo)

Hostage families demand action

Families of Israeli hostages protest outside the Prime Minister’s office, urging for the swift return of their loved ones. (AP photo)

Devastating toll of conflict

The Gaza war’s staggering toll is laid bare, with over 47,000 Palestinians and 1,210 Israelis killed, predominantly civilians, as per reliable sources. (AP photo)
